Dryer duct cleaning services involve the thorough removal of lint, dust, and debris from the ventilation systems that connect a clothes dryer to the exterior of a property. This process typically includes inspecting the ductwork, cleaning out accumulated material, and ensuring that the entire pathway is clear and functioning properly. Regular cleaning helps prevent blockages that can hinder dryer performance and reduce energy efficiency, making laundry routines more effective and less costly over time.
One of the primary issues addressed by dryer duct cleaning is the buildup of lint, which can pose a fire hazard if left unchecked. Over time, lint particles can accumulate within the duct, restricting airflow and forcing the dryer to work harder. This not only increases energy consumption but also raises the risk of overheating and potential fires. Additionally, clogged ducts can cause longer drying times, leading to frustration and higher utility bills. Service providers help mitigate these problems by removing debris and improving airflow, promoting safer and more efficient dryer operation.

Homeowners typically consider dryer duct cleaning when experiencing specific issues such as longer drying times, a burning smell during operation, or visible lint around the appliance or vent. It’s also recommended as part of routine maintenance if the dryer is used frequently or if the property has not had the ducts cleaned in several years. Recognizing these signs and scheduling professional cleaning can help prevent potential hazards, improve dryer efficiency, and extend the lifespan of the appliance. The overview below groups typical Dryer Duct Cleaning proj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in your area.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Smaller Repairs - typical costs for routine dryer duct cleaning range from $100 to $250. Many standard jobs fall within this range, especially for homes with straightforward duct systems. Larger or more complex projects may cost more, but they are less common.
Mid-Range Cleaning - for more thorough cleaning or moderate duct system issues, local contractors often charge between $250 and $600. This is a common price band for most residential dryer duct cleaning services.
Full Duct System Replacement - replacing or extensively repairing dryer duct systems can range from $600 to $1,500 or more. These larger projects are less frequent but necessary for severely damaged or outdated systems.
Complex or Commercial Jobs - larger, more complex projects such as commercial dryer vent systems or extensive ductwork can reach $2,000 to $5,000+ depending on size and complexity. Such projects are relatively rare compared to standard residential services.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.
